Get-AzStorageEncryptionScope
Versleutelingsbereiken ophalen of weergeven vanuit een opslagaccount.
Syntaxis
Get-AzStorageEncryptionScope
[-ResourceGroupName] <String>
[-StorageAccountName] <String>
[-EncryptionScopeName <String>]
[-MaxPageSize <Int32>]
[-Filter <String>]
[-Include <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Get-AzStorageEncryptionScope
-StorageAccount <PSStorageAccount>
[-EncryptionScopeName <String>]
[-MaxPageSize <Int32>]
[-Filter <String>]
[-Include <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Description
De Get-AzStorageEncryptionScope cmdlet haalt versleutelingsbereiken op uit een opslagaccount of vermeldt deze.
Voorbeelden
Voorbeeld 1: Eén versleutelingsbereik ophalen
Get-AzStorageEncryptionScope -ResourceGroupName "myresourcegroup" -AccountName "mystorageaccount" -EncryptionScopeName $scopename
ResourceGroupName: myresourcegroup, StorageAccountName: mystorageaccount
Name State Source KeyVaultKeyUri
---- ----- ------ --------------
testscope Disabled Microsoft.Keyvault https://keyvalutname.vault.azure.net:443/keys/keyname
Met deze opdracht krijgt u één versleutelingsbereik.
Voorbeeld 2: alle versleutelingsbereiken van een opslagaccount weergeven
Get-AzStorageEncryptionScope -ResourceGroupName "myresourcegroup" -AccountName "mystorageaccount"
ResourceGroupName: myresourcegroup, StorageAccountName: mystorageaccount
Name State Source KeyVaultKeyUri
---- ----- ------ --------------
testscope Disabled Microsoft.Keyvault https://keyvalutname.vault.azure.net:443/keys/keyname
scope2 Enabled Microsoft.Storage
Met deze opdracht worden alle versleutelingsbereiken van een opslagaccount weergegeven.
Voorbeeld 3: Een lijst weergeven van alle ingeschakelde versleutelingsbereiken van een opslagaccount met een maximale paginagrootte van 10 voor elke aanvraag
Get-AzStorageEncryptionScope -ResourceGroupName "myresourcegroup" -AccountName "mystorageaccount" -MaxPageSize 10 -Include Enabled
ResourceGroupName: myresourcegroup, StorageAccountName: mystorageaccount
Name State Source KeyVaultKeyUri
---- ----- ------ --------------
scope1 Enabled Microsoft.Keyvault https://keyvalutname.vault.azure.net:443/keys/keyname
scope2 Enabled Microsoft.Storage
Met deze opdracht worden alle ingeschakelde versleutelingsbereiken van een opslagaccount weergegeven, met een maximale paginagrootte van 10 versleutelingsbereiken die zijn opgenomen in elk lijstantwoord. Als er meer dan 10 versleutelingsbereiken moeten worden weergegeven, worden met de opdracht nog steeds alle versleutelingsbereiken weergegeven, maar met meerdere aanvragen die zijn verzonden en antwoorden ontvangen.
Voorbeeld 4: Alle uitgeschakelde versleutelingsbereiken weergeven met namen die beginnen met 'testen' van een opslagaccount
Get-AzStorageEncryptionScope -ResourceGroupName "myresourcegroup" -AccountName "mystorageaccount" -Include Disabled -Filter "startswith(name, test)"
ResourceGroupName: myresourcegroup, StorageAccountName: mystorageaccount
Name State Source KeyVaultKeyUri
---- ----- ------ --------------
testscope1 Disabled Microsoft.Keyvault https://keyvalutname.vault.azure.net:443/keys/keyname
testscope2 Disabled Microsoft.Storage
Met deze opdracht worden alle uitgeschakelde versleutelingsbereiken weergegeven met namen die beginnen met 'test' van een opslagaccount. De parameter Filter geeft het voorvoegsel van de vermelde versleutelingsbereiken op en moet de indeling 'startswith(name, {prefixValue})' hebben.
Parameters
-DefaultProfile
De referenties, accounts, tenants en abonnementen die worden gebruikt voor communicatie met Azure.
Type: | IAzureContextContainer |
Aliassen: | AzContext, AzureRmContext, AzureCredential |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
-EncryptionScopeName
Azure Storage EncryptionScope-naam
Type: | String |
Aliassen: | Name |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
-Filter
Het filter van de naam van het versleutelingsbereik. Wanneer dit is opgegeven, worden alleen namen van versleutelingsbereiken weergegeven die beginnen met het filter.
Type: | String |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
-Include
Het filter van de naam van het versleutelingsbereik. Wanneer dit is opgegeven, worden alleen namen van versleutelingsbereiken weergegeven die beginnen met het filter.
Type: | String |
Geaccepteerde waarden: | All, Enabled, Disabled |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
-MaxPageSize
Het maximum aantal versleutelingsbereiken dat wordt opgenomen in het lijstantwoord
Type: | Nullable<T>[Int32] |
Position: | Named |
Default value: | None |
Vereist: | False |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
-ResourceGroupName
Naam van resourcegroep.
Type: | String |
Position: | 0 |
Default value: | None |
Vereist: | True |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
-StorageAccount
Opslagaccountobject
Type: | PSStorageAccount |
Position: | Named |
Default value: | None |
Vereist: | True |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| False |
-StorageAccountName
Naam van opslagaccount.
Type: | String |
Aliassen: | AccountName |
Position: | 1 |
Default value: | None |
Vereist: | True |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
Invoerwaarden
Uitvoerwaarden
Azure PowerShell